Subject: Re: Teen Slang Terms (Gank and Gaffle)



My students (mostly Southern California transplants) have been reporting

"gank" on slang surveys for 4 years. Most of them have no idea where it

comes from but a few have suggested, rightly, I think, that it derives

from "gangster/a" (those aren't gender markings, just dialect variation).
